Fasten your karate belt and compete

Karatekas from Lambton's Tebbutts Mixed Martial Arts Academy are preparing to compete at a karate tournament set to take place in September.

The Development Karate Tournament is scheduled to take place at the Kempton Park Indoor Sport Centre, corner of Plane and Green Avenues, on September 12.

Lambton’s Tebbutts Mixed Martial Arts Academy will be among the clubs competing at the competition.

“We are in training at the moment and hope to produce great results at the tournament,” said the club’s Master Alex Tebbutt.

“We always participate in this competition and we always put on our best performance.”

Semi and light contact, musical forms and musical weapons will be the styles to witness at the event.

The weigh-in will take place on the day, from 7am to 8.30am with, the action kicking off at 9am.

Entry fees vary for first and extra events.
